Im *hoping* to release an application that I developed in Java, and I
want to release a free version as well as a pay version.
Clearly I want to be able to avoid people cracking it, or creating key
generators... Although i know that it is unlikely to actually stop
them entirely.. I want to do as much as I can to ensure that IF they
want to crack/keygen it, that it will be as difficult as possible.
Please let me know what your thoughts are as to how to achieve this.
Strategies? Resources?
Please send them my way!
If you have no idea how to do start, forget about doing it on your
own. All the crackers out there have way more experience than you (because
you have zero experience!) and so you don't stand a chance.
If you really need copyprotection for your software, license a scheme
from a third party. Just be careful not to get a scheme that people
really, really hate (e.g. StarForce).
